Just 20 minutes north of Cairns, Yorkeys Knob offers a peaceful, tropical setting where locals and visitors can unwind, explore and enjoy the natural surroundings. With panoramic views of the Coral Sea and the Macalister Range, this coastal village is full of easy pleasures and quiet charm.


Whether you're planning a full-day adventure, group outing, or just a relaxed morning, there’s no shortage of things to enjoy in Yorkeys Knob. Here are some of the most popular activities to try during your visit:


  • Try Kitesurfing: Yorkeys is one of the region’s best spots for kitesurfing, with gear hire and lessons available for beginners and thrill-seekers alike.


  • Walk the Beach & Esplanade: Take a gentle stroll along Sims Esplanade or enjoy sunrise by the sea on the wide, uncrowded beach.


  • Explore Local Parks & Lookouts: Find shade and sea views at Ray Howarth Park or take in the coastal scenery from grassy picnic spots.


  • Discover Local Art: Spot driftwood sculptures and quirky creative touches scattered along the foreshore.
